Resende - Dry Port receives authorization from Anvisa

08.25.2014

On July 28th, the Resende Dry Port, operated by the Multiterminais Group, received authorization from the Anvisa Agency to operate Cosmetics, hygienic products, fragrances and food products, as published in the Oficial Gazette.

In its Customs Bonded refrigerated area of 1,023.76 m², Multiterminais is apt to receive cosmetics and food products, where all benefits from Dry Ports can be applied, including differentiated Customs Regimes.

This area is divided into three distinct parts:

Anti-chamber
With a total area of 203 m², the anti-chamber is divided into receiving, expedition, segregation and handling areas.

Chamber 01 (Cosmetics, hygiene products and fragrances)
With a total area of 410.38 m², Chamber 01 is divided into warehousing and quarantine areas.

Chamber 02 (Food)
With a total area of 410.38 m2, Chamber 02 is divided into warehousing and quarantine areas.
